Islets of Langerhans•Islet Potency Index

▫FDA requirement for use as a biological drug▫Sterility, identity, and purity are established

•Reliably predict transplant outcomes▫Glucose-stimulated insulin secretion; β-cell specific▫In-vivo streptozotocin treated mice; Potency Index▫UIC-MS islet assays▫Phase III human clinical trials*; 52-week follow-up

•Microfluidic optimization▫Ca2+; Mitochondrial Potential; Insulin release▫High-throughput assays

Human Islet Cell Composition• 6 isolations• 32 sampled islets

• Rangesα-cells 28 – 75%β-cells 10 – 65%δ-cells 1 – 22%

Assessment of Human Pancreatic Islet Architecture and Composition by Laser Scanning Confocal MicroscopyJournal of Histochemistry & Cytochemistry; Volume 53(9): 1087–1097, 2005Marcela Brissova, Michael J. Fowler, Wendell E. Nicholson, Anita Chu, Boaz Hirshberg, David M. Harlan, and Alvin C. Powers
